White matter is found in the deeper tissues of the brain (subcortical). It contains nerve fibers (axons), which are extensions of nerve cells (neurons). Many of these nerve fibers are surrounded by a type of sheath or covering called myelin. Myelin gives the white matter its color.People also ask, what is white matter of the brain?

The CNS has two kinds of tissue: grey matter and white matter, Grey matter, which has a pinkish-grey color in the living brain, contains the cell bodies, dendrites and axon terminals of neurons, so it is where all synapses are. White matter is made of axons connecting different parts of grey matter to each other.

White matter. White matter is composed of bundles, which connect various gray matter areas (the locations of nerve cell bodies) of the brain to each other, and carry nerve impulses between neurons. White matter in nonelderly adults is 1.7–3.6% blood.What is white matter on MRI?
White matter hyperintensities (WMHs) are lesions in the brain that show up as areas of increased brightness when visualised by T2-weighted magnetic resonance imaging (MRI). White matter injuries occur when white matter tracts (bundles of myelinated axons) are damaged. As long as the neuron cell bodies remain healthy, axons can regrow and slowly repair themselves. Functional recovery may also occur if the information can be transmitted through an alternative route.Can you die from white matter disease?

White matter disease (WMD) covers a large group of disorders that affect the white matter, or myelin. In children these disorders are commonly genetic and often go undiagnosed. In 1995 experts discovered an autosomal recessive myelin disorder called megalencephalic leukoencephalopathy with subcortical cysts (MLC).What is white matter signal abnormality?
